Fan-out backpressure for the Quillet notifier: when the queue depth crosses the soft limit, the dispatcher sheds low-priority pushes and batches the rest at 500ms intervals. Reviewer should confirm the shed counter is exported and that retries respect the jitter window. Once merged, the release artifact gets re-signed by the pipeline, which expects the deploy key shown below.

deploy key for bawep-yawif: bky6_GQhaSt

Data Stores: Idempotency Keys (Tollgate Payments)

Every retry of a payment capture carries an idempotency key derived from the order hash plus attempt epoch. Keys live in the ledger-side store with a 72-hour TTL; duplicates short-circuit before the processor call. Reviewers verifying dedup behavior should query the keys table via the connection string below.

replica DSN, yahog-kawig: redis://istox_svc:um@db-8a67.halixforge.test:5432/frawyn

Subject: Handover — Fieldmoth offline mode bits

Hey Priya-replacement (sorry, still don't know your name!),

Quick rundown before I'm out. Fieldmoth's offline mode queues survey responses on the device and syncs them to the staging store when crews get back in range. The conflict resolver runs nightly — don't touch the merge rules without pinging the apps team first, they're touchy about it. Everything else is documented on the wiki. To get at the staging store, use the connection string below.

replica DSN, kajep-yahag: mssql://praok_svc:iF@db-8d68.plorvaio.local:5432/eliion